Scottish Hotel Owner Discovers Face of E.T. in a Tree Trunk

E. TREE?
Apparently E.T. didn't make it back to his home planet. He ended up in Scotland...in a tree? In the land where Nessie supposedly resides, a hotel owner recently discovered the face of E.T. the Extra-Terrestrial in a tree trunk.

"We kid you knot," says Billy Harley, the proprietor of the Uig Hotel on the Isle of Skye. Harley was the Elliot who spotted smiling E.T. "inside the trunk of a tree he was chopping to make firewood for the popular bar of his hotel."

Harley was quoted as saying, “The weather has got a lot colder in the last week and I was getting some additional logs ready to keep the place warm for our guests. I put the chainsaw through a trunk and there was ET staring back at me. I phoned home and my wife brought a camera out to take some pictures.”

Harley's plans are uncertain, “We’re not quite sure what to do now. We could turn ET into a coffee table or a bar stool maybe.” So you can potentially enjoy your scotch whilst sitting on the tree face of a famous movie alien.

The Isle of Skye is certainly an appropriate place for E.T. to end up and the Harley family is hoping his appearance will drum up business and draw in folks who are "perhaps wishing for a glimpse in the sky of ET’s parents coming to collect him." They are also considering naming one the hotel rooms after the world-famous alien.
